City Guide
Jiancheng, Sichuan, China
Overview
Jiancheng is a mid-sized city in Sichuan province, blending traditional Sichuanese culture with modern amenities and scenic river views. Its busy markets, historic sites, and laid-back parks make it welcoming for visitors seeking an authentic local experience.
Best Time to Visit
March-May for pleasant spring temperatures and September-October for autumn charm.
Local Tips
Cash payment is preferred at small shops and markets. Try local specialties like Sichuan hotpot and street snacks. Public transport is reliable and affordable.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is uncommon. Dress modestly when visiting temples. Politeness and patience are appreciated, especially in family-run businesses.
Safety Warnings
Jiancheng is generally safe; stay alert for pickpockets in crowded markets. Avoid isolated alleys late at night and double-check taxi meters.
Hidden Gems
Explore the centuries-old Buddhist temple on the city outskirts, enjoy the morning dance gatherings in Riverside Park, and seek out small teahouses off the main streets for a true Jiancheng experience.
